#ifndef _ACOBJECT_H |
#define _ACOBJECT_H |
|
/* acpisrc:struct_defs -- for acpisrc conversion */ |
|
/* |
* The union acpi_operand_object is used to pass AML operands from the dispatcher |
* to the interpreter, and to keep track of the various handlers such as |
* address space handlers and notify handlers. The object is a constant |
* size in order to allow it to be cached and reused. |
* |
* Note: The object is optimized to be aligned and will not work if it is |
* byte-packed. |
*/ |
#if ACPI_MACHINE_WIDTH == 64 |
#pragma pack(8) |
#else |
#pragma pack(4) |
#endif |
|
/******************************************************************************* |
* |
* Common Descriptors |
* |
******************************************************************************/ |
|
/* |
* Common area for all objects. |
* |
* descriptor_type is used to differentiate between internal descriptors, and |
* must be in the same place across all descriptors |
* |
* Note: The descriptor_type and Type fields must appear in the identical |
* position in both the struct acpi_namespace_node and union acpi_operand_object |
* structures. |
*/ |
#define 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ER \ |
union acpi_operand_object *next_object; /* Objects linked to parent NS node */\ |
u8 descriptor_type; /* To differentiate various internal objs */\ |
u8 type; /* acpi_object_type */\ |
u16 reference_count; /* For object deletion management */\ |
u8 flags; |
/* |
* Note: There are 3 bytes available here before the |
* next natural alignment boundary (for both 32/64 cases) |
*/ |
|
/* Values for Flag byte above */ |
|
#define AOPOBJ_AML_CONSTANT 0x01 /* Integer is an AML constant */ |
#define AOPOBJ_STATIC_POINTER 0x02 /* Data is part of an ACPI table, don't delete */ |
#define AOPOBJ_DATA_VALID 0x04 /* Object is initialized and data is valid */ |
#define AOPOBJ_OBJECT_INITIALIZED 0x08 /* Region is initialized, _REG was run */ |
#define AOPOBJ_SETUP_COMPLETE 0x10 /* Region setup is complete */ |
#define AOPOBJ_INVALID 0x20 /* Host OS won't allow a Region address */ |
|
/****************************************************************************** |
* |
* Basic data types |
* |
*****************************************************************************/ |
|
struct acpi_object_common {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ER}; |
|
struct acpi_object_integer {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ER u8 fill[3]; /* Prevent warning on some compilers */ |
u64 value; |
}; |
|
/* |
* Note: The String and Buffer object must be identical through the |
* pointer and length elements. There is code that depends on this. |
* |
* Fields common to both Strings and Buffers |
*/ |
#define ACPI_COMMON_BUFFER_INFO(_type) \ |
_type *pointer; \ |
u32 length; |
|
struct acpi_object_string { /* Null terminated, ASCII characters only */ |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ER ACPI_COMMON_BUFFER_INFO(char) /* String in AML stream or allocated string */ |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_buffer {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ER ACPI_COMMON_BUFFER_INFO(u8) /* Buffer in AML stream or allocated buffer */ |
u32 aml_length; |
u8 *aml_start; |
struct acpi_namespace_node *node; /* Link back to parent node */ |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_package {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ER struct acpi_namespace_node *node; /* Link back to parent node */ |
union acpi_operand_object **elements; /* Array of pointers to acpi_objects */ |
u8 *aml_start; |
u32 aml_length; |
u32 count; /* # of elements in package */ |
}; |

/****************************************************************************** |
* |
* Complex data types |
* |
*****************************************************************************/ |
|
struct acpi_object_event {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ER acpi_semaphore os_semaphore; /* Actual OS synchronization object */ |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_mutex {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ER u8 sync_level; /* 0-15, specified in Mutex() call */ |
u16 acquisition_depth; /* Allow multiple Acquires, same thread */ |
acpi_mutex os_mutex; /* Actual OS synchronization object */ |
acpi_thread_id thread_id; /* Current owner of the mutex */ |
struct acpi_thread_state *owner_thread; /* Current owner of the mutex */ |
union acpi_operand_object *prev; /* Link for list of acquired mutexes */ |
union acpi_operand_object *next; /* Link for list of acquired mutexes */ |
struct acpi_namespace_node *node; /* Containing namespace node */ |
u8 original_sync_level; /* Owner's original sync level (0-15) */ |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_region {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ER u8 space_id; |
struct acpi_namespace_node *node; /* Containing namespace node */ |
union acpi_operand_object *handler; /* Handler for region access */ |
union acpi_operand_object *next; |
acpi_physical_address address; |
u32 length; |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_method {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ER u8 info_flags; |
u8 param_count; |
u8 sync_level; |
union acpi_operand_object *mutex; |
union acpi_operand_object *node; |
u8 *aml_start; |
union { |
acpi_internal_method implementation; |
union acpi_operand_object *handler; |
} dispatch; |
|
u32 aml_length; |
u8 thread_count; |
acpi_owner_id owner_id; |
}; |
|
/* Flags for info_flags field above */ |
|
#define ACPI_METHOD_MODULE_LEVEL 0x01 /* Method is actually module-level code */ |
#define ACPI_METHOD_INTERNAL_ONLY 0x02 /* Method is implemented internally (_OSI) */ |
#define ACPI_METHOD_SERIALIZED 0x04 /* Method is serialized */ |
#define ACPI_METHOD_SERIALIZED_PENDING 0x08 /* Method is to be marked serialized */ |
#define ACPI_METHOD_IGNORE_SYNC_LEVEL 0x10 /* Method was auto-serialized at table load time */ |
#define ACPI_METHOD_MODIFIED_NAMESPACE 0x20 /* Method modified the namespace */ |
|
/****************************************************************************** |
* |
* Objects that can be notified. All share a common notify_info area. |
* |
*****************************************************************************/ |
|
/* |
* Common fields for objects that support ASL notifications |
*/ |
#define ACPI_COMMON_NOTIFY_INFO \ |
union acpi_operand_object *notify_list[2]; /* Handlers for system/device notifies */\ |
union acpi_operand_object *handler; /* Handler for Address space */ |
|
struct acpi_object_notify_common { /* COMMON NOTIFY for POWER, PROCESSOR, DEVICE, and THERMAL */ |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ER ACPI_COMMON_NOTIFY_INFO}; |
|
struct acpi_object_device {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ER |
ACPI_COMMON_NOTIFY_INFO struct acpi_gpe_block_info *gpe_block; |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_power_resource {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ER ACPI_COMMON_NOTIFY_INFO u32 system_level; |
u32 resource_order; |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_processor {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ER |
/* The next two fields take advantage of the 3-byte space before NOTIFY_INFO */ |
u8 proc_id; |
u8 length; |
ACPI_COMMON_NOTIFY_INFO acpi_io_address address; |
}; |
|
struct acpi_object_thermal_zone {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ER ACPI_COMMON_NOTIFY_INFO}; |

/****************************************************************************** |
* |
* Special internal objects |
* |
*****************************************************************************/ |
|
/* |
* The Reference object is used for these opcodes: |
* Arg[0-6], Local[0-7], index_op, name_op, ref_of_op, load_op, load_table_op, debug_op |
* The Reference.Class differentiates these types. |
*/ |
struct acpi_object_reference {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ER u8 class; /* Reference Class */ |
u8 target_type; /* Used for Index Op */ |
u8 reserved; |
void *object; /* name_op=>HANDLE to obj, index_op=>union acpi_operand_object */ |
struct acpi_namespace_node *node; /* ref_of or Namepath */ |
union acpi_operand_object **where; /* Target of Index */ |
u8 *index_pointer; /* Used for Buffers and Strings */ |
u32 value; /* Used for Local/Arg/Index/ddb_handle */ |
}; |
|
/* Values for Reference.Class above */ |
|
typedef enum { |
ACPI_REFCLASS_LOCAL = 0, /* Method local */ |
ACPI_REFCLASS_ARG = 1, /* Method argument */ |
ACPI_REFCLASS_REFOF = 2, /* Result of ref_of() TBD: Split to Ref/Node and Ref/operand_obj? */ |
ACPI_REFCLASS_INDEX = 3, /* Result of Index() */ |
ACPI_REFCLASS_TABLE = 4, /* ddb_handle - Load(), load_table() */ |
ACPI_REFCLASS_NAME = 5, /* Reference to a named object */ |
ACPI_REFCLASS_DEBUG = 6, /* Debug object */ |
|
ACPI_REFCLASS_MAX = 6 |
} ACPI_REFERENCE_CLASSES; |
|
/* |
* Extra object is used as additional storage for types that |
* have AML code in their declarations (term_args) that must be |
* evaluated at run time. |
* |
* Currently: Region and field_unit types |
*/ |
struct acpi_object_extra {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ER struct acpi_namespace_node *method_REG; /* _REG method for this region (if any) */ |
struct acpi_namespace_node *scope_node; |
void *region_context; /* Region-specific data */ |
u8 *aml_start; |
u32 aml_length; |
}; |
|
/* Additional data that can be attached to namespace nodes */ |
|
struct acpi_object_data {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ER acpi_object_handler handler; |
void *pointer; |
}; |
|
/* Structure used when objects are cached for reuse */ |
|
struct acpi_object_cache_list { |
ACPI_OBJECT_COMMON_HEADER union acpi_operand_object *next; /* Link for object cache and internal lists */ |
}; |
|
/****************************************************************************** |
* |
* union acpi_operand_object descriptor - a giant union of all of the above |
* |
*****************************************************************************/ |
|
union acpi_operand_object { |
struct acpi_object_common common; |
struct acpi_object_integer integer; |
struct acpi_object_string string; |
struct acpi_object_buffer buffer; |
struct acpi_object_package package; |
struct acpi_object_event event; |
struct acpi_object_method method; |
struct acpi_object_mutex mutex; |
struct acpi_object_region region; |
struct acpi_object_notify_common common_notify; |
struct acpi_object_device device; |
struct acpi_object_power_resource power_resource; |
struct acpi_object_processor processor; |
struct acpi_object_thermal_zone thermal_zone; |
struct acpi_object_field_common common_field; |
struct acpi_object_region_field field; |
struct acpi_object_buffer_field buffer_field; |
struct acpi_object_bank_field bank_field; |
struct acpi_object_index_field index_field; |
struct acpi_object_notify_handler notify; |
struct acpi_object_addr_handler address_space; |
struct acpi_object_reference reference; |
struct acpi_object_extra extra; |
struct acpi_object_data data; |
struct acpi_object_cache_list cache; |
|
/* |
* Add namespace node to union in order to simplify code that accepts both |
* ACPI_OPERAND_OBJECTs and ACPI_NAMESPACE_NODEs. The structures share |
* a common descriptor_type field in order to differentiate them. |
*/ |
struct acpi_namespace_node node; |
}; |
